Understanding Boat Carpet Logos

Before delving into design options, it's crucial to understand what makes a boat carpet logo effective. A well-designed logo should be visible yet subtle, complementing rather than overwhelming your boat's interior. It should also be durable, withstanding the wear and tear of marine life.

Quality craftsmanship is key. Look for logos made from marine-grade materials, designed to withstand moisture, UV rays, and heavy foot traffic. The design should be cut precisely, with clean edges and no fraying. A good logo should be a long-term investment, not a quick fix.

Custom Logo Design

For a truly unique touch, consider a custom boat carpet logo. This could be a personal emblem, a family crest, or a symbol that represents your love for the water. To create a custom logo, work with a professional designer who understands marine graphics. They can help you translate your vision into a durable, eye-catching design.

When designing a custom logo, consider the size, color, and placement. A larger logo can make a bold statement, while a smaller one adds a subtle touch of personalization. Choose colors that complement your boat's interior and exterior. As for placement, logos can be placed on the floor, on seat backs, or even on wall-to-wall carpeting.

Pre-Designed Logos

If a custom logo isn't your style, there are plenty of pre-designed options available. These can range from nautical themes to abstract patterns, offering a wide variety of styles to suit different tastes. Pre-designed logos are often more affordable than custom designs, making them a great option for budget-conscious boat owners.

When choosing a pre-designed logo, consider the overall aesthetic of your boat. A classic boat might look best with a traditional nautical design, while a modern vessel could benefit from a more abstract pattern. Don't be afraid to mix and match, using different logos in different areas of your boat's interior.

Installing Boat Carpet Logos

Once you've chosen your logo, it's time to install it. This can be a DIY project for the handy, or a job for a professional marine carpet installer. If you're installing the logo yourself, follow these steps:

1. Measure the area where you want to place the logo. Cut the carpet to size, leaving a small border for installation. 2. Apply a marine-grade adhesive to the back of the logo and the area where it will be placed. 3. Carefully position the logo, using a ruler or straight edge to ensure it's straight. 4. Use a roller or your hands to press the logo into place, smoothing out any bubbles or wrinkles. 5. Allow the adhesive to cure according to the manufacturer's instructions before using the area.

Caring for Your Boat Carpet Logos

With proper care, your boat carpet logos can last for years. Regular cleaning is key. Vacuum the area regularly to remove dirt and debris. For deeper cleaning, use a marine-grade carpet cleaner, following the manufacturer's instructions.

To protect your logos from fading, keep your boat out of direct sunlight as much as possible. When you're not using your boat, cover it with a marine-grade cover to protect the interior from the elements. With proper care, your boat carpet logos can remain a vibrant, personalized touch for years to come.
